What is the deadline for Pennsylvania rent rebate?
Harrisburg, PA – Treasurer Stacy Garrity continues to urge eligible Pennsylvanians to apply for the state’s Property Tax/Rent Rebate Program. The Pennsylvania Department of Revenue recently announced the deadline to submit applications has been extended from June 30, 2021, to December 31, 2021.

Article first time published onDoes Pennsylvania have a rent rebate?
The Property Tax/Rent Rebate Program benefits Pennsylvanians age 65 and older, widows and widowers age 50 and older, and people with disabilities age 18 and older. The program has annual income limits of $35,000 for homeowners and $15,000 for renters.
What is a rent rebate in PA?
The Pennsylvania Property Tax or Rent Rebate Program is a program that provides rebates on property tax or rent paid in the previous year by any income-eligible seniors, as well as individuals with disabilities.

Why are PA rent rebates delayed?
The rent and property tax rebate program typically sends checks of up to $650 to eligible seniors in July. … Revenue Department spokesman Jeffrey Johnson blamed the pandemic for the delays, saying the department was unable to hire temporary employees during tax season because of health concerns.

How long does it take to get tax refund?
If you file a complete and accurate paper tax return, your refund should be issued in about six to eight weeks from the date IRS receives your return. If you file your return electronically, your refund should be issued in less than three weeks, even faster when you choose direct deposit.

How long does it take to get renters rebate in MN?
When to Expect Your Refund If the department receives your properly completed return and all enclosures are correct and complete, you can expect your refund: by mid-August if you are a renter or mobile home owner and you file by June 15, or within 60 days after you file, whichever is later.
